Pole barn services typically involve the construction, repair, or modification of pole barns, which are versatile structures supported by vertical posts embedded in the ground. These services may include installing new pole barns for storage, workshops, or livestock shelters, as well as upgrading existing structures to improve stability or expand usable space. Skilled contractors work with homeowners to ensure the design and build meet specific needs, whether it’s creating a large open space for equipment or a smaller shelter for animals. The process often involves site preparation, setting posts securely, framing, and finishing touches to deliver a durable and functional structure.

The overview below groups typical Pole Barn Service proj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in your area.
In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.
Smaller Repairs - Typical costs for minor pole barn repairs, such as replacing damaged siding or fixing leaks, generally range from $250 to $600. Many routine jobs fall within this middle range, with fewer projects reaching the higher end of the spectrum.
Partial Renovations - More extensive updates, like upgrading doors or adding insulation, usually cost between $1,000 and $3,500. These projects are common and tend to stay within this moderate price range, though larger upgrades can cost more.
Full Replacement - Replacing an entire pole barn or performing major structural work can range from $10,000 to $25,000 or more. Such large projects are less frequent and typically fall into the higher cost brackets due to scope and materials involved.
Custom Builds - Custom-designed pole barns tailored to specific needs often start around $20,000 and can exceed $50,000 for complex, large-scale structures. These projects are less common and generally represent the upper end of typical costs.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.
